Balancing a Scat cast crank

cast cranks are lighter by the manufacturing process. they are less dense than a forged (compressed) crank so your going to have to add weight to the throws to compensate for 1-heavier bobweight of rods and pistons or 2. lighter balance throws to begin with. I think your fighting 2, lighter throws. Tungsten is going to have to be added to the throws to make the bobweight compensation heavier. They had to use external balancing on cast crank 360 and 340 motors because the cranks were lighter by about 5 lbs with all other parts being the same as the forged crank motors so they had to add weight where they could externally, the balancer and the convertor or flywheel. I dont see an issue making it an external, you just have to supply and weighted 360 B&M flex plate and a cast 340/360 balancer, then weight can be taken from these parts. Anything can be internally balanced but at a cost of mallory metal/tungsten.
